Which of the following best describes one reason that the National Association for the Advancement of Colored People was formed?
Thepotemich [5.8K]

The correct answer is letter C.

Explanation: National Association for the Advancement of Colored People the leading association for the defense of black rights and the fight against racism in the United States. Mainly composed of black Americans, but with many whites as members, aimed at ending racial discrimination and segregation, the entity was formed as a result of the lynching of two blacks in Springfield, Illinois, in 1908.
